STATE COLLEGE, Pa.
A Pennsylvania beauty queen has been jailed on charges she faked having leukemia to benefit from fundraisers, and will be stripped of her title.
Online court records show Brandi Lee Weaver-Gates, 23, of State College was arraigned Tuesday on charges of theft by deception and receiving stolen property.
State police say an April bingo benefit raised $14,000 for the recently crowned Miss Pennsylvania U.S. International pageant winner.
Butler’s Beauties, the company that sponsors the pageant, says in a Facebook page statement that it also was “led to believe that she was dealing with this horrible disease” and are making her return her crown and sash.
State police said Wednesday that they were getting calls from people reporting they donated money to support Weaver-Gates.
“We’re expecting an overwhelming response from victims to come forward,” Trooper Thomas Stock of the Rockview station said Wednesday.
The state police investigation into Weaver-Gates started after troopers got an anonymous tip that she was “faking” having cancer, according to court documents.
The tipster reached out after she called Johns Hopkins Medical Center in Baltimore, where Weaver-Gates said she was receiving treatment, to make a donation to Weaver-Gates’ medical bills. The hospital reported that Weaver-Gates was not a patient there.
The tipster reported that Weaver-Gates also told her that she received treatment at other facilities, including UPMC Altoona and Geisinger Medical Center. When investigators contacted each of the hospitals, employees reported there was no record of Weaver-Gates ever being there, or had been there years ago, before her alleged diagnosis with leukemia in 2013.
Stock said Wednesday that police haven’t yet determined a total amount raised to cover Weaver-Gates’ medical expenses, but there were four fundraisers held to contribute to medical bills. One event, called Bingo for Brandi, raised about $14,000, according to court documents.
Organizers from that event set up an account from the proceeds and would write checks to Weaver-Gates as she provided treatment bills, Stock said.
“We do have a copy of one bill that we’ve verified is a fake bill,” Stock said.
Investigators haven’t found any evidence that Weaver-Gates has any kind of medical condition, Stock said.
Weaver-Gates was being held Wednesday at Centre County Correctional Facility in lieu of $150,000 bail.
